CERTIFICATES AND OTHER DOCUMENTS REQUIRED AT THE TIME OF COUNSELING AND ADMISSION :
Certificates and documents required to be submitted by all candidates selected for admission to various programmes of study at the time of counseling / written test/ admission / registration.

1) Ten copies of recent passport size photographs.

2) Two self-attested copies of marks sheet(s) of 10th, 12th, Graduation & Post Graduation or an equivalent examination certificate, showing the age/date of birth of the candidate.

3) A character certificate from the Head of the Institution last attended.

4) Fitness certificate issued by registered medical practitioner.

5) Transfer / Migration Certificate (in original) from the Head of the Institution/University last attended:
i. All those candidates who have passed their qualifying examination prior to 2015 must produce the Migration Certificate from the University from where they have passed their qualifying examination at the time of admission/registration failing which they will not be granted admission.

ii. Candidates who have passed their qualifying examination in 2015 and are not in a position to submit the Migration Certificate at the time of admission, should submit the same as early thereafter as possible, but not later than six weeks after the commencement of the Monsoon Semester, failing which the University reserves the right to cancel their admission.

6) For SC / ST Candidates: Attested copy of SC/ ST Certificate in the prescribed format issued only by an officer not below the rank of Magistrate/ Tehsildar in support of their claim for admission against the reserved quota.

7) OBC candidates: Copy of OBC Certificate issued by District Magistrate/Deputy Commissioner in the prescribed format. Also, bring income certificate.

8) For PWD Candidates: Medical Certificate issued by the Competent Medical Authority indicating the nature and extent (including percentage) of Physical Disability in support of their claim for admission against reserved quota.

9) Income certificate, if applicable.

10) BPL Certificate, if applicable.

11) The admission of candidates who have passed their qualifying examination from a Foreign University will be subject to their qualification being found equivalent to the qualifications prescribed by the University.

12) The candidates enjoying employed status and selected for admission to any programme of study in the University, are required to produce LEAVE SANCTION/RELIEVING ORDER AT THE TIME OF ADMISSION/ REGISTRATION from their employer for the duration of the programme permitting them to pursue their studies at the University, failing which the offer of admission shall stand withdrawn.

13) Candidate MUST come prepared to pay the requisite admission fees (excluding Hostel charges, etc.).

Important : The candidate will be allowed to register only IN PERSON. The candidate is also required to produce all originals of the above certificates/documents for verification at the time of registration/admission. In the absence of any of the original certificates/documents, registration/admission shall not be allowed. The original certificates of the candidate will be retained by the University for a period of one semester.
